Security for Beneficiaries' Passions
To make certain the security of recipients' passions, probate bonds play an essential role in estate administration by providing a financial safeguard in cases of mismanagement or misbehavior. These bonds work as a kind of insurance coverage that safeguards the beneficiaries from potential losses as a result of the activities of the estate administrator or administrator.
In circumstances where the executor fails to satisfy their obligations properly or engages in deceptive tasks, the probate bond makes sure that the recipients obtain their entitled properties. This defense is vital for recipients that may not have straight control over the estate's administration and require assurance that their passions are secure.
Legal Conformity and Satisfaction
Guaranteeing legal conformity with probate bond requirements gives comfort for beneficiaries and safeguards their interests in estate preparation. By requiring the administrator or administrator of an estate to get a probate bond, the legal system guarantees that the individual managing the estate's events is held accountable for their actions. This accountability provides a layer of protection for recipients, ensuring them that the estate will certainly be taken care of sensibly and ethically.
Probate bonds additionally serve as a lawful safeguard in case the executor falls short to satisfy their duties properly. In such instances, recipients can sue against the bond to seek compensation for any financial losses sustained because of the administrator's misconduct or oversight. This lawful recourse uses beneficiaries a sense of security, recognizing that there are procedures in position to address any possible mishandling of the estate.
Eventually, by adhering to probate bond needs, recipients can feel confident that their interests are protected, and estate planning is accomplished in a clear and authorized manner.
